Seite 1 von 1

Frage zu Mailbenachrichtigungen

Verfasst: 31.08.2005 16:34
von Morpheus-LB
Hallo zusammen.

Mir ist aufgefallen, daß wenn ich in meinem Board eine PM bekomme, steht in der dazugehörigen Mail "Hallo xy!".

Wenn ich eine Mail bekomme, in der ich auf ein neues Post zu einem abon. Thema hingewiesen werden, steht in der Mail nur "Hallo!".

Obwohl in der "privmsg_notify.tpl" und in der "topic_notify.tpl" die selbe Anrede steht, nämlich "Hallo {USERNAME}!".

Warum funktioniert das bei der einen Mail (PM) und bei der anderen nicht ?


Gruß
MrGates

Verfasst: 31.08.2005 16:45
von kellanved
Weil nur eine Email an alle Empfänger (Abonennten) rausgeht.

Verfasst: 31.08.2005 16:51
von Morpheus-LB
Aber wieso steht dann in beiden Templets "Hallo {USERNAME}!" ?

Dann sollte es doch auch funktionieren.

Verfasst: 31.08.2005 16:58
von kellanved
Das war sicher anfangs mal anders geplant gewesen, dann aber aus Performancegründen geändert worden.

Ein Eintrag in einem phpBB Template ändert leider nicht das SMTP Protokoll. Er ändert noch nicht einmal den dahinterliegenden phpBB Code.

Verfasst: 31.08.2005 17:11
von Morpheus-LB
hmm...versteh ich jetzt nicht so ganz...

Ob nun eine Mail verschickt wird, wenn eine neue PM eingetroffen ist, oder eine Mail verschickt wird, wenn ein neuer Beitrag geschrieben wurde.

Die "Leitung der Mail" ist doch die selbe...es wird nur ein anderes Templet angesprochen, mir einem anderen Text drin...

Oder seh ich das jetzt total verkehrt ???

Für Aufklärung wäre ich sehr dankbar. ;)

Verfasst: 31.08.2005 17:29
von kellanved
Das Stichwort ist "eine".
Im Falle der PN hat die Mail genau einen Empfänger, im Falle der Benachrichtigung aber mehrere, u.U. sehr sehr viele.
:wink: